Types of Tile Shower Walls
There are several types of tile shower walls to choose from, each with its unique characteristics and benefits:

1. Ceramic and Porcelain Tiles: These tiles are made from clay and other minerals, fired at high temperatures to create a durable and water-resistant surface. They're available in a wide range of colors, patterns, and styles.
2. Glass Tiles: Glass tiles are made from tempered glass, offering a sleek and modern appearance. They're resistant to water and stains, making them perfect for shower areas.
3. Natural Stone Tiles: Marble, granite, and travertine tiles are popular choices for tile shower walls, offering a luxurious and unique appearance. They're durable and resistant to water, but require regular sealing to maintain their appearance.

Tile Shower Wall Installation
Proper installation is crucial for a successful tile shower wall project:
1. Prepare the Surface: Ensure the surface is clean, dry, and level, applying a layer of adhesive as needed.
2. Lay the Tiles: Begin laying the tiles from the center of the wall, working your way outward in a pattern.
3. Grout the Tiles: Apply grout between the tiles, wiping away excess with a damp cloth.
4. Seal the Tiles: Apply a tile sealant to protect the tiles from stains and water damage.
